我现在遇到一个问题想请教各位前辈,不知sas可不可以进行不同档案数据比对的功能?如我现在有两个不同的档案(内容如檔A和檔C),我想说可不可以利用檔A和檔C的比较而产生出檔B呢?
其三者之间的关系说明如下:
首先,檔B和檔C其实为同一个档案,差在檔B比檔C多出一些空格(和檔A比较后产生出结果)。如檔A的A5和檔C的N2因子值是一样的,因此想将两笔数据合并,进而产生出檔B,而檔C的N3和檔A的B5之间差了两笔数据,虽这边我们舍去不用,但会补上空白值来替代(两笔格式相同之空白值),因而变成檔B。而B15和N4的形式也和上面是一样的,因中间差了9条数据,因此产生出文件B的H15(补上9笔空白的资料)。那我想请问各位前辈,我应该如何写SAS程序才有办法达成比对档A和文件B的数据而产生出文件C呢?
http://blog.eyny.com/space-6057703-do-album-picid-4516730-goto-down.html